How Our Standing Water Removal Process Works
When you call us, our team will dispatch a crew to your property to assess the damage and develop a customized plan. Our process typically takes 3-5 days to complete, depending on the severity of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water, dry the affected area, and restore your home to its original cond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technician will arrive at your property to assess the damage and identify the source of the standing water. We’ll then develop a customized plan to address the issue and restore your home.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our truck-mounted extractors, we’ll remove the standing water from your property. This equipment can extract up to 10 gallons of water per minute, making the process much faster and more efficient.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ry the affected area and remove any remaining moisture. This step is critical to preventing further damage and promoting a healthy environment.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, our technician will cl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, such as drywall, flooring, or cabinets.

Standing Water Removal Cost in Gwynn, VA
The cost of standing water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Gwynn, VA.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, but can be higher or lower depending on the spec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ning needed |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ed |
